Dynamic array of objects in c++

WebJan 8, 2010 · and the implicit comment by many posters => Dont use arrays, use vectors. All of the benefits of arrays with none of the downsides. PLus you get lots of other … WebJan 18, 2024 · A Computer Science portal for geeks. It contains well written, well thought and well explained computer science and programming articles, quizzes and …

dynamic array of objects c++

WebNov 30, 2013 · works only if the Stock class has a zero argument constructor if it does not have any zero argument constructor you cannot create an array of dynamic objects … WebFeb 19, 2024 · folly/dynamic.h. folly/dynamic.h provides a runtime dynamically typed value for C++, similar to the way languages with runtime type systems work (e.g. Python). It can hold types from a predetermined set of types (ints, bools, arrays of other dynamics, etc), similar to something like boost::variant, but the syntax is intended to be a little more ... ease4声学模拟软件 https://chansonlaurentides.com

Java Program to Access All Data as Object Array

WebOct 29, 2012 · Then you can initialize all this pointers to objects Foo. for (int i=0;i<10;i++) array [i] = new Foo ();// Give memory to pointers of object Foo in array. assign null to … WebDec 31, 2024 · The objects of the class geek calls the function and it displays the value of dynamically allocated variable i.e ptr. Below is the program for dynamic initialization of … WebSep 19, 2012 · When you add an object and the array is too small you need to create a new one with the correct or larger size, copy the data, delete the old one and replace it … ct swain\u0027s

Set array of object to null in C++ - Stack Overflow

Category:C++ dynamic array of dynamic strings - Stack Overflow

Tags:Dynamic array of objects in c++

Dynamic array of objects in c++

C++ Dynamic Allocation of Arrays with Example - Guru99

WebOct 25, 2024 · Similarly, if you want to have a pointer to an array of objects then you’re happy to do it in C++: ... Guess who was there for the rescue, in a case where std::vector didn’t work, and I needed to allocate a dynamic array cleanly? :-) If you're interested in smart pointers - have a look at my handy reference card. WebJan 11, 2024 · Dynamic Array Using calloc () Function. The “calloc” or “contiguous allocation” method in C is used to dynamically allocate the specified number of blocks of …

Dynamic array of objects in c++

Did you know?

Webinitializes the array elements to zero. length is set to 10 and nextIndex to 0. The constrcutor is called when an object is created by e.g. Dynarry da; The destructor Dynarray::~Dynarray() { delete [] pa; } When a object of type Dynarray is created on the stack, as it will be by the above declaration, then care WebJan 3, 2024 · Data Structure &amp; Algorithm-Self Paced(C++/JAVA) Data Structures &amp; Algorithms in Python; Explore More Self-Paced Courses; Programming Languages. C++ Programming - Beginner to Advanced; Java Programming - Beginner to Advanced; C Programming - Beginner to Advanced; Web Development. Full Stack Development with …

WebA declaration of the form T a [N];, declares a as an array object that consists of N contiguously allocated objects of type T.The elements of an array are numbered 0, …, N - 1, and may be accessed with the subscript operator [], as in a [0], …, a [N -1].. Arrays can be constructed from any fundamental type (except void), pointers, pointers to members, … WebApr 26, 2024 · In above example, we have created an array of 3 objects and delete it using statement delete [] pen; if we look at the output the class constructor and destructor were called 3 times each. means, we have deleted objects properly. Now, If we delete the object using the statement “delete pen” ( This is general mistake a programmer make) then ...

WebJul 19, 2024 · 4. Firstly main must return int. Then you need to create an array of pointers which will show to abstract class Figure. Figure **dyn_arr = new Figure* [size]; Then if … WebNov 17, 2024 · An array of a class type is also known as an array of objects. Example#1: Storing more than one Employee data. Let’s assume there is an array of objects for …

WebMay 9, 2024 · In C++, "dynamic array" is spelled std::vector. With it, you won't need to count the records beforehand. With it, you won't need to count the records beforehand. – …

WebJan 12, 2013 · In the last step create 1000 objects of type Node and attach their addresses to the first of your 100 pointers. some [0] [0] = new Node [numY]; //numY = 1000. In the … cts wagon wikiWebMar 7, 2024 · In C++, the objects can be created at run-time. C++ supports two operators new and delete to perform memory allocation and de-allocation. These types of objects … ease 5feWebMay 4, 2010 · General C++ Programming; ... Dynamic Array of Objects . Dynamic Array of Objects. xeyide. I'm working with a simple object "Fraction." It holds a numerator and … ease 4.0 ibaWebDec 8, 2016 · Instead of having arrayOfAs be an array of A objects, ... this is just some beginners thing where there's a syntax that actually works when attempting to dynamically allocate an array of things that have internal dynamic allocation. (Also, style critiques … ease44connectWebWe use the GetType method to get the type of the dynamic object and the GetProperties method to get an array of PropertyInfo objects that represent the properties of the … cts wagon with sedan springsWebNov 12, 2024 · Although both C and C++ both have a dynamic memory allocation feature, C++ has made it more elegant. Dynamic Memory Management. The allocation or … ease 4.0WebMar 1, 2024 · C++ program to create a simple class and object; C++ Create an object of a class and access class attributes; C++ Create multiple objects of a class; C++ Create class methods; C++ Define a class method outside the class definition; C++ Assign values to the private data members without using constructor cts wagons for sale